From 2c6d4548c5a163ff17f4c0d1cebaf65c467c1ba4 Mon Sep 17 00:00:00 2001 From: Harsh Shandilya Date: Sat, 20 Jun 2020 12:19:55 +0530 Subject: UserPreference: fix my inability to count (#863) --- app/src/main/java/com/zeapo/pwdstore/UserPreference.kt |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'app/src/main/java/com/zeapo') diff --git a/app/src/main/java/com/zeapo/pwdstore/UserPreference.kt b/app/src/main/java/com/zeapo/pwdstore/UserPreference.kt index cd01c883..0ed1a66a 100644 --- a/app/src/main/java/com/zeapo/pwdstore/UserPreference.kt +++ b/app/src/main/java/com/zeapo/pwdstore/UserPreference.kt @@ -676,7 +676,7 @@ class UserPreference : AppCompatActivity() { // TODO: This is fragile. Workaround until PasswordItem is backed by DocumentFile val docId = DocumentsContract.getTreeDocumentId(uri) val split = docId.split(":".toRegex()).dropLastWhile { it.isEmpty() }.toTypedArray() - val path = if (split.isNotEmpty()) split[1] else split[0] + val path = if (split.size > 1) split[1] else split[0] val repoPath = "${Environment.getExternalStorageDirectory()}/$path" val prefs = PreferenceManager.getDefaultSharedPreferences(applicationContext) -- cgit v1.2.3